Elizabeth Johnson is the co-founder and Executive Director of the Peaceful Presence Project, a community-based organization in Oregon dedicated to fostering compassionate end-of-life care. Her commitment to supporting end of life planning for the unhoused population is deep, leading her to companion homeless individuals to help them complete their advance directives. The Peaceful Presence Project offers numerous resources, including end of life doula training and a free downloadable resource called End Notes that guides the user in gathering the documents their loved ones will need, and the wishes they want honored, into one place. The End Notes workbook comes in both digital and printable formats.   Find the work of the Peaceful Presence Project: Website: thepeacefulpresence.org Learn more about The Peaceful Presence Project Connect with their End of Life Doula Course Download the End Notes resource here Social media for the Peaceful Presence Project:  Instagram  LinkedIn Podcast host Helen Bauer is a great addition to your event or conference!
